Output 588545832d4465cf5dd1e23f428022fe156dbf8c5d97ca02f157cfbaa4be7130:1

value
22734175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bd08ff3ba7eab2545aa566dccd4884d684d81b7 OP_EQUALVERIFY OP_CHECKSIG
address
17usXYwxKk2YDjueBbERY4BvxAAVS4asjz
transaction
588545832d4465cf5dd1e23f428022fe156dbf8c5d97ca02f157cfbaa4be7130
spent
true